
Good News for our McDonald’s lovers out there because their website has revealed their next set of happy meal toys to feature characters from Transformers Robot in Disguise. According to what’s shown, we will be getting a robot mode and a vehicle mode figure each for our Autobot heroes Bumblebee and Optimus Prime, as well as Thunderhoof and Steeljaw from the Decepticon crew. Most of the figures appear to have a projectile firing gimmick of some sort, with Optimus Prime’s projectile featuring Minicon Slipstream‘s likeness.
